How it works
- Tell us the location, the date, and what the video is for, whether it is a website hero, a social media post, or event coverage.
- We check the airspace and handle any permits. Los Angeles has controlled airspace near LAX, Burbank, Van Nuys, Long Beach, and Santa Monica airports, and SkyeCam manages all authorizations with the FAA.
- The shoot day usually runs one to three hours, depending on the location and the number of shots you need.
- We edit the footage, deliver the finished files, and provide one round of revisions.

Can you fly indoors?
Yes. FPV drones and small camera drones can fly indoors with the venue’s permission. This works well for gyms, warehouses, showrooms, and large interior spaces where a ground-level camera cannot capture the full scale. We coordinate with the venue in advance and confirm that the space is safe for flight.
How far ahead should I book?
For most locations, a week or two of notice is enough. If your shoot is in controlled airspace near an airport, or if you need a night flight, longer notice is better because the authorization process takes additional time. SkyeCam will tell you on the phone what the lead time needs to be for your specific location.
Do you need a permit to film my business?
It depends on the location and the airspace. Some areas require a city or county film permit, and flights near airports require FAA authorization. SkyeCam checks the airspace, files the necessary paperwork, and confirms the flight is legal before you go to any trouble preparing for the shoot.
